Caldertop Cottage - Preston, Lancashire



Set in the Forest of Bowland,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, Caldertop Cottage is beautifully located for a holiday in Lancashire. The cottage adjoins the owners' farmhouse on a working sheep and stock rearing farm with spectacular views over open countryside. Higher Landskill Farm is a wonderful base for walkers and cyclists with several footpaths and cycle routes on the doorstep. The open rushy pastures are an ideal habitat for lapwings, curlews, snipe and oystercatchers which can all be observed from the bird hide on the farm.

The cottage sleeps 5 people and 1 baby and has a double bedroom, twin bedroom, single bedroom and a family bathroom. Downstairs there is a fully equipped kitchen/dining room, cosy lounge with open fire, utility room and cloakroom. A cot and highchair are available. Bed linen, towels, electricity and heating are included. Outside there is an enclosed garden with garden furniture, barbecue, swings, slide and trampoline.

A 10 minute walk will take you to the pretty village of Calder Vale where there is a small shop and post office. Homemade refreshments are served in the village hall every Sunday afternoon during the month of May when the bluebells are flowering in the church wood. The market town of Garstang, the world's first fairtrade town, is 5 miles away. Here you will find supermarkets, banks, shops, cafes, pubs and restaurants. The Lake District National Park, Blackpool and the Yorkshire Dales are all within easy travelling distance.
